A lot has changed in the Mapletish sports scene for this season. Firstly we take a look at the current number of professional sporting clubs in Mapletish. Before this season started, the number of sporting clubs in Mapletish spiked to a record high of 32 while in previous season, the numbers are down to 20, one of the lowest in recent history. This is due to the merger of the clubs and withdrawal from other clubs due to financial, sustainability or management issues. Listed are the 20 professional sports clubs that will be present from this season on. I cannot be sure if these clubs will stick around for the next few seasons or so, but 1 thing I am well confident of is that, these are some of the more stable clubs in the Maplish sporting scene with a reliable fan base and a rich long history that accompanies them. But who knows? In this dynamic sporting scene in Mapletish, time will tell whether these clubs can survive this environment.

We will first start off with Mapletish's most popular sport and that is none other than Association Football. Football in Mapletish has certainly changed a whole lot since Season 1 and just recently, Season 16 was concluded. It has an entirely new format starting from Season 15 with a 64 team professional league structure split into 4 divisions. Taking the top division is the Primero Liga, which is cut from 20 teams, followed by the Segunda Campeonatos, Liga Tercero and Liga Cuarto.

Season 16 saw Versatio Giants shocked everyone and took the Primero Liga in the second half of the season. If we look at the previews, we are all sure that Golden Phoenix will be a strong contender to retain their title while the odds are certainly tipped in Home United's favour. But, it was Versatio Giants which were the eventual winners of their maiden title. Concluding their maiden win, they join the exclusive club of champions and are a "One-Timer Club' now together with SC Galatasaray, Celtics Rovers, Club Atletico and Balmope Betis which have all won 1 Primero Liga in their campaigns in the top flight.

The season curtain riser was a clash between the two arch rivals, Home United and Golden Phoenix. With a Super Classico so early in the season, we certainly saw plenty of goal mouth action and exciting plays from both ends of the pitch in the Mapletish National Stadium which saw Home United beat Golden Phoenix 4-2 with an exciting hat trick by Leandro Cloe. Leandro Cloe is certainly likened to be the new leader in the front line for the Dragons. This creative attacking midfielder has been on the lips of the Protectors' fans all season and he recently won the Golden Boot, Golden Ball for overall top goal scorer and best overall player on the pitch all season.

Right up on the overall look on the league, Versatio Giants win the title 2 points ahead of Home United, while SC Galatasaray and Golden Phoenix round up the top 4. This season also saw SC Barcelona and Bury Town, the two were promoted from the Segunda, finished in the 7th and 8th respectively, presenting fairly challenging and competitive matches with them as they took on the top flight. Catanzaro, the other team to have promoted to the Primero Liga, finished 6 points from safety above the drop zone, which sealed their victims, Woodlands United, Moonchester United and Heywood City. Starting in Season 17, there will only be 2 football club in the Primero Liga, following the relegation of football clubs Woodlands United and Heywood, and the promotion of Celtics Rovers, Lazio and SC Milan. The domination of sports clubs have been highly evident in the Primero Liga which is filled with Big 20 teams.

If we look beyond the Primero Liga, we can also see sports clubs in the Segunda Campeonatos and Liga Tercero. In Season 16, Southampton, Pittsburgh, Djax, Struggait United, Celtics Rovers, SC Milan and SC Las Palmas played their trade in the Segunda while fellow Big 20 club, SC Porto played in the Liga Tercero. This will continue as a trend though in Season 17. Amongst the Big 20, SC Porto gets their promotion to the Segunda following a 3rd place finish while Djax, Struggait United and SC Las Palmas saw a drop in their divisions as they finished in the last 3 of the Segunda. Moonchester City was one point away from safety as they stayed afloat in the Segunda for another season. Further upwards, we see Southampton and Pittsburgh finished 4th and 5th respectively while Celtics Rovers, a Primero Liga winner and SC Milan promoted to the Primero Liga.

We can certainly see how Djax, Struggait United and SC Las Palmas, getting a cut in resources for the football department in the next season or we can see a large injection of resources in these areas for them to get ahead and into the Primero Liga. However you see it, we can be assured that the Liga Tercero is certainly not a desirable place to be in, considering their status. They would be giants in the 3rd division of the football league structure. If we take a look at sponsorship revenue in general, these 3 clubs going down to the Tercero are miles ahead in sponsorship revenue, an average per season sponsorship income of USD$45 million for these clubs while clubs down in the third tier have an average per season sponsorship income of only USD$12 million.

The increasing disparity between single sport and multi-sport clubs have continued in recent years as multi-sport clubs generally consolidate their resources and are generally run like large corporations with extensive resources and large earning capabilities through multiple channels like merchandising, commercials, sponsorship, broadcasting and matchday revenues. In this aspect. As seen in Mapletish's context, the top tier professional sports leagues in Association Football, rugby, ice hockey and basketball, used in comparison are all dominated by the professional sports clubs while the semi-professional and amateur single sport clubs in general filled the semi-pro and amateur leagues.

This can be seen as a positive side to professional sports as the athletes represent the elite in the Union and they are well paid whlist performing at the top levels. While on the other hand, semi-professional and amateur clubs cater to athletes who do what they do because of their love and passion for their sport. Some of them maybe, do what they do to get their chance in getting pro. The professional clubs have done what they do best and are always on the lookout for talents outside of the professional arena, constantly scouring in the non professional sports scene too. In recent years, Sunday League players have been called up for the Maplish squad in the NS World Cup too, so that shows the depths and layers that our amateur athletes can provide too.

Besides multi-sport clubs which continue to dominate the national sports headlines, single sport clubs have also made their impact in the Maplish sports scene. A prime example would be football development by football clubs in the Mapletish Football League, where single sport clubs get one of the largest exposure in. Single sport professional clubs are made possible right here because of the competitiveness that these clubs have continued to provide over the seasons. The Mapletish Cup carried a great example here when Schalke 07, a Liga Tercero shocked Home United 4-1 at home in their 1st round match up leaving the Protectors stunned and bruised and held them to a 0-0 draw in a return fixture to knock the Protectors out in the first round for the first time in their Mapletish Cup history. Segunda Campeonatos team Auckland Rovers stretched their winning run in the Mapletish Cup to the quarter-finals where they were defeated 3-2 on aggregate by Bury Town in a close match up against the Segunda Campeonatos Season 15 champions. In another matchup, CA Knights managed a winning run to the semi-finals before being defeated by finalists Golden Eagles 5-4 on aggregate. CA Knights turned their focus towards the football department after the sports club was faced with financial issues which saw them pulling out from the other professional sports leagues and turned their focus towards managing a professional football team instead while running its other departments semi-professionally or by not having a team in that department altogether. Their downsizing affected them quite a bit but they maintained their mid table finish in Season 16, finishing 6 points from safety.

This has been good for sports nonetheless. Multi-sports clubs have also played an integral role in youth sports development, often supporting local clubs through affiliation in developing and identifying potential talented athletes for their respective sport. This involved role that multi-sports clubs play have also reached into schools as these clubs play a more extensive role in the integrating the sports development model in Mapletish as clubs work with academic institutions to identify potential talent pools.

In addition, a representative sports team has also played a role in each region's cultural identity. Each of the sports clubs have a strong regional following with them. Two sports clubs in 1 region has not exactly fared well in this area, as most sports clubs eventually merged sooner if not later despite providing exciting derby encounters. All this with the exception of Home United, Struggait United and Golden Phoenix in Struggait who are local rivals but also regional rivals. These 3 clubs also have regional followings in other than their home region. Struggait United also has a strong supporter following in the region North of Struggait, the Central Midlands region One might also think that Moonchester United and Moonchester City are from the same region but they are more of competitive rivals then local rivals as they are from two different regions.

Ice hockey is one of the more popular sports in Mapletish, together with the National team's strong showings in the World Cup of Hockey many editions ago, ice hockey has been a sport with rising and thriving popularity amongst Maplish. Historically, the sport has been limited mainly by geographical zones since snow is not something that is prevalent throughout Mapletish. Winter sports is the mainstay for regions in the higher altitudes with snowy winters, and the traditional heavy weights Home United and Golden Phoenix are favourite clubs in a slightly hilly Struggait region, with snowy winters. This is evident in their strong ice hockey cultures. The two rivals are also the MNHL's only league winners since its inception. Modern day games though have expanded with the introduction of indoor rinks, now even predominantly sunny regions have a shot at putting ice-hockey teams, case in point, SC Las Palmas and SC Porto.

Season 5 was a shocker as the title went to Struggait United, the smallest of the Struggait teams. The minnows of Struggait shocked everyone else and won the title comfortably with 4 points ahead of Celtics Rovers. Home United, the traditional heavyweights finished in third in a lacklustre season by their standards. All- Sunny Las Palmas finished just behind Home United, while the latter's arch rivals, Golden Phoenix finished 17th, in one of the most uncomfortable of finishes. Series of unfortunate defeats saw Golden Phoenix miss out on the Cherries Cup playoff and HCL. Southampton put in a consistent showing as they finished in the Cherries Cup's playoff spot, while fellow rivals Northampton made it into the top 8 too, finishing the "Thampton" round up. Club Atletico too finished in the top 8, carrying their Cherries Cup's playoff streak into Season 5 from Season 4. Galatasaray rounded up the top 8 after missing out from the top 8 by 11 points in Season 4.

The reformed MNHL allowed a more round robin style as each sport club play each other thrice with the top 8 rounding up for a single legged post season Cherries Cup to determine the Post Season's winner. Struggait United, Celtics Rovers, Home united, SC Las Palmas, Southampton, Club Atletico, Northampton and SC Galatasaray rounds the Cherries Cup with Home United taking home the honours once again, for what would be their 4th win. Home United got through with a tight 4-3 win over Celtics Rovers, a 3-2 win over fellow Struggaiters, Struggait United and got one over Northampton in the Finals shootout 1-0 to keep their streak alive.
